Press the Windows key + X on your keyboard
Click prompt (Admin)
At the command prompt, type:
sfc/scannow
Press enter
This will check for any breach of integrity
Restart your system
If the problem persists, try to do a refresh:
Here's what happens when you refresh your PC:
· Your files and your personalization settings do not change.· Your PC will change back to their default values.
· Applications on Windows Store will be kept.
· Applications that you have installed discs or sites Web is removed.
· A list of removed apps will be saved to your desktop.
These steps will take you through refreshing your PC:
· Press the Windows key + C on your keyboard to show the charms (if you use a touch screen: touch the right edge of your screen and drag your finger to the left)
· Click settings
· Click change PC settings
· Click general in the left column
· Under refresh your PC without affecting your files, click Start
Then follow the instructions that will be provided on-screen to cool your PC.

Often, a certain instability in Windows Explorer is due to the defective shell extensions and addons.Consider using Sysinternals Autoruns or ShellExView. Disable Add-ons and non Microsoft shell extensions and verify the behavior. If he went, reactivate the disabled extensions/add-ons, one at a time and see if you can identify who may be liable.Try a clean boot, or boot into safe mode. The behavior persists?If you continue to experience the problem, consider creating the hierarchy of following registry keys in the registry:HKLM\Software\Microsoft\Windows\Windows error Reporting\LocalDumps\explorer.exe\In the explorer.exe key, create a REG_EXPAND_SZ value named DumpFolder and set the value to%systemdrive%\localdumpsdata. Ensure that the %systemdrive%\localdumps file exists, and then cause the crash to happen. It must be a dump file in %systemdrive%\localdumps. Download the dump on your SkyDrivefile.(Letter is an environment variable that represents the system drive, usually C:.) -

Windows Explorer crashes when the click with the right button on folders
My Windows Explorer crashes whenever I right click on a folder, any folder. It is for me a "Windows Explorer has stopped working" then it gives me a warning 'Windows restarts. Then he closes my Explorer window. I tried many things to see if that would help and nothing has done so far. Anyone has any suggestions on how to solve this problem or knows what could be the problem?
Click right problems are very often caused by third-party programs adding entries in the context menu. Here is a program that can help you manage these inscriptions: http://www.nirsoft.net/utils/shexview.html. Here, another article written for XP, but it applies to Vista that may be useful: http://windowsxp.mvps.org/context_folders.htm.

When you right-click on the desktop or the window displaying the contents of a folder and select 'New', you see a list of the types of documents you can create. How to add and delete?
When you right-click on the desktop or the window displaying the contents of a folder and select 'New', you see a list of the types of documents you can create. How to add and delete?
With regedit , you can see a lot of extensions of files known, for example, H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\.txt for txtfile. To get rid of the "new extension" option in all of the folders that you can rename the key HKCR\.txt\ShellNew to HKCR\.txt\ShellNew.disabled or similar.
Some applications can open empty files, for example, Notepad can open a (new) empty text file. For the purposes of C:\windows\shellnew which is indicated by an empty string (REGSZ) NullFile. -
